What does a propulsion performance engineer do?

A Propulsion Performance Engineer is responsible for analyzing, modeling, and optimizing the performance of propulsion systems such as jet engines, rocket engines, or other powerplants used in aerospace vehicles. They use simulation tools and test data to evaluate engine efficiency, thrust, fuel consumption, and emissions, ensuring that propulsion systems meet design requirements and safety standards. Their work often involves collaborating with design, testing, and manufacturing teams to improve system performance and troubleshoot issues throughout the development lifecycle.

What are the key skills and qualifications needed to thrive as a propulsion performance engineer, and why are they important?

To thrive as a Propulsion Performance Engineer, you need a solid background in aerospace or mechanical engineering, strong analytical skills, and experience with propulsion systems, often supported by a relevant engineering degree. Proficiency with simulation tools such as MATLAB, CFD software, and engine performance modeling platforms is typically required. Strong problem-solving skills, attention to detail, and effective communication abilities set candidates apart in this role. These skills are crucial for accurately predicting and optimizing propulsion system performance, ensuring safety, efficiency, and innovation in aerospace projects.

How do propulsion performance engineers typically collaborate with other engineering teams during a project?

Propulsion Performance Engineers work closely with multidisciplinary teams, including aerodynamics, systems, and integration engineers. They often participate in design reviews, share performance data, and help troubleshoot issues that arise during testing or simulations. Effective communication and collaboration are vital, as propulsion performance must align with overall vehicle requirements and constraints. This cross-functional teamwork is key to ensuring the propulsion system meets safety, efficiency, and mission objectives.

Boeing Phantom Works is seeking an experienced Low Observable (LO) Propulsion Integration Engineer to lead LO integration of propulsion systems for advanced stealth aircraft programs. The ideal candidate will possess deep technical expertise in propulsion integration, LO design principles, and systems engineering, and will work across multidisciplinary teams to ensure propulsion system performance while maintaining stringent signature, thermal, and structural requirements.

Position Responsibilities:

  • LO propulsion integration activities for advanced platforms across concept, design, test, and qualification phases

  • Develop and validate propulsion system LO architectures that meet performance, LO signature, and thermal management requirements

  • Conduct trade studies, signature modeling, and sensitivity analyses for inlet, nozzle, and exhaust treatments

  • Interface with aerodynamicists, structures, materials, thermal management, and signature engineering teams to ensure cohesive design solutions

  • Define requirements, perform risk assessments, and establish verification/validation plans for propulsion integration items

  • Support hardware design reviews (PDR/CDR), test planning, and ground/flight test execution to verify LO and propulsion performance

  • Mentor junior engineers and provide technical leadership within the LO discipline

  • Produce and review technical documentation, specifications, and interface control documents (ICDs)
